Compare all specifications:
2006 GMC Yukon | 2008 Saturn Outlook | |
Make | GMC | Saturn |
Model | Yukon | Outlook |
Year Released | 2006 | 2008 |
Body Type | SUV |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4802 cc | 3564 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Horse Power | 285 HP | 270 HP |
Engine RPM | 5200 RPM | 6600 RPM |
Torque | 400 Nm | 373 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4000 RPM | 6600 RPM |
Drive Type | 4WD | Front |
Number of Seats | 6 seats | 8 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 5060 mm | 5110 mm |
Vehicle Width | 2010 mm | 2010 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1950 mm | 1860 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2950 mm | 3030 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 98 L | 83 L |
